There are some EXTREME misconceptions of those who are overweight and underweight.  While there are those with a VERY unhealthy relationship with food that requires intervention, there are MANY who are trying to implement healthy habits and still struggling on one end of the spectrum or the other.  But WHY? It always comes down to the foundations which in Nutritional Therapy we focus on digestion, blood sugar regulation, fatty acids, hydration, and minerals.....along with other healthy habit implementation.
